Watchung Reservation: A Natural Haven

One of the most popular hiking destinations in the area is Watchung Reservation. Spanning over 2,000 acres, this expansive park offers a myriad of trails that weave through diverse landscapes, including forests, meadows, and wetlands.

Trails to Explore

  • Sierra Trail: A well-marked 10-mile loop that takes hikers through various terrains, providing an excellent opportunity to experience the park's diverse ecosystem.

  • Lake Surprise Trail: A scenic route that leads to the picturesque Lake Surprise, perfect for a peaceful walk and bird-watching.
Watchung Reservation is also home to the Deserted Village of Feltville, a historical site that offers a glimpse into the area's past. The combination of natural beauty and historical intrigue makes this reservation a must-visit.

Ash Brook Reservation: A Hidden Gem

Located within Scotch Plains itself, Ash Brook Reservation is a lesser-known but equally enchanting spot for hiking enthusiasts. This 1.5-mile trail meanders through serene woodlands and offers a peaceful retreat from the hustle and bustle of everyday life.

Highlights

  • Wildlife Observation: The reservation is a haven for bird watchers and wildlife enthusiasts. Keep an eye out for deer, foxes, and a variety of bird species.

  • Quiet Trails: The trails here are less crowded, making it an ideal spot for those seeking solitude and a more meditative hiking experience.

Hawk Rise Sanctuary: An Urban Oasis

A short drive from Scotch Plains, Hawk Rise Sanctuary in Linden offers a unique blend of urban and natural environments. This 95-acre ecological preserve features a 1.5-mile trail that takes hikers through forests, meadows, and wetlands.

Features

  • Educational Signage: Along the trail, you'll find informative signs about the local flora and fauna, making it a great educational outing for families.

  • Scenic Views: Elevated boardwalks provide stunning views of the Rahway River and the surrounding marshlands.
Hawk Rise Sanctuary is an excellent option for those looking to enjoy a quick nature escape close to Scotch Plains.

South Mountain Reservation: A Hiker's Paradise

A bit farther afield, South Mountain Reservation in Essex County is worth the trip for its extensive trail network and breathtaking views. Spanning over 2,000 acres, this reservation offers something for everyone.

Notable Trails

  • Hemlock Falls Trail: A moderate 5.8-mile loop that features a beautiful waterfall, perfect for a refreshing break.

  • Rahway Trail: A challenging 7-mile trail that rewards hikers with panoramic views of the New York City skyline.
South Mountain Reservation also features a variety of amenities, including picnic areas, making it a great spot for a full-day adventure.

Lenape Park: A Historical Path

Lenape Park, located near Cranford, is part of the larger Rahway River Parkway. This park offers a pleasant hiking experience with its well-maintained trails and historical significance.

Trail Highlights

  • Lenape Trail: This 2.5-mile trail follows the Rahway River and is steeped in history, as it traces the path used by the Lenape Native Americans.

  • Wildlife and Bird Watching: The park is known for its rich biodiversity, making it a prime spot for nature enthusiasts.
The serene environment of Lenape Park provides a perfect backdrop for a leisurely hike, allowing hikers to connect with nature and history simultaneously.

Nomahegan Park: Family-Friendly Fun

For those seeking a family-friendly hiking experience, Nomahegan Park in Cranford is an ideal choice. This park features a 1.9-mile loop around a picturesque lake, perfect for a relaxed outing with children.

Amenities

  • Playgrounds and Picnic Areas: The park offers several recreational facilities, making it a great spot for a family day out.

  • Easy Trails: The flat, well-paved paths are accessible for strollers and wheelchairs, ensuring everyone can enjoy the natural beauty.

Nomahegan Park's welcoming atmosphere and scenic beauty make it a favorite among locals for casual hikes and outdoor activities.

Tips for Hiking in Scotch Plains and Surrounding Areas

To make the most of your hiking adventures in and around Scotch Plains, consider the following tips:

  • Plan Ahead: Check trail maps and weather conditions before heading out. Some trails might be more challenging after rain or during winter.

  • Dress Appropriately: Wear sturdy hiking shoes and dress in layers to accommodate changing weather conditions.

  • Stay Hydrated: Carry enough water, especially during warmer months.

  • Respect Nature: Follow Leave No Trace principles by carrying out all trash and staying on designated trails to protect the environment.
